Newcastle fans have had plenty to cheer this season, not least the form of Demba Ba, who eased the pain of losing Andy Carroll by notching goals against all opposition as Alan Pardew’s side chase an unlikely European spot. Right now, however, Ba has taken a step back and allowed compatriot Papiss Cisse to come to the fore. Cisse has racked up seven goals in as many games, without completing a full 90 minutes, and will be looking to add another to the tally at Swansea in this afternoon’s Easter opener. Paddy included the Newcastle man in their goalscoring treble with Cisse, Van Persie and Rooney at 7/1 to all score over their first set of Easter fixtures. With 54 goals between them, we’ll gladly open our account with a fiver on this one.

After the tragic heart condition that struck Fabrice Muamba at White Hart Lane in March, Bolton’s form has gone from strength to strength, belying doubts that they could struggle following the abandoned quarter final. Martin Petrov has played a significant role in this recent success, both as provider and goalscorer. Paddy are offering a lofty 14/1 for Petrov to score and Bolton to keep a clean sheet at home to Fulham in their first Easter fixture. Although Bolton have won their last three, they have also been conceding, so £1 is risk enough for us here.

Antonio Valencia has been on fire of late, and although pundits questioned the intent for his deadlock breaker against Blackburn on Monday night, nobody could deny he produced another electric performance. Paddy are playing odds on Valencia close to their chest after his productive spell, offering 100/30 on a Valencia assist and clean sheet for United against QPR. A lot of risk for little reward, but with £14 in the kitty to spend over this weekend, a cheeky £1.50 still leaves us with plenty to play with.
